> Switch the setting of psl_fir_cntl from debug to production
> environment recommended value. It mostly affects the PSL behavior when
> an error is raised in psl_fir1/2.
> 
> Tested with cxlflash.

> diff --git a/drivers/misc/cxl/pci.c b/drivers/misc/cxl/pci.c
> index bf56468..4aea07e 100644
> --- a/drivers/misc/cxl/pci.c
> +++ b/drivers/misc/cxl/pci.c
> @@ -357,7 +357,7 @@ static int init_implementation_adapter_regs(struct cxl *adapter, struct pci_dev
>  {
>  	struct device_node *np;
>  	const __be32 *prop;
> -	u64 psl_dsnctl;
> +	u64 psl_dsnctl, psl_fircntl;
>  	u64 chipid;
>  	u64 capp_unit_id;
>  
> @@ -386,8 +386,11 @@ static int init_implementation_adapter_regs(struct cxl *adapter, struct pci_dev
>  	cxl_p1_write(adapter, CXL_PSL_RESLCKTO, 0x20000000200ULL);
>  	/* snoop write mask */
>  	cxl_p1_write(adapter, CXL_PSL_SNWRALLOC, 0x00000000FFFFFFFFULL);
> -	/* set fir_accum */
> -	cxl_p1_write(adapter, CXL_PSL_FIR_CNTL, 0x0800000000000000ULL);
> +	/* set fir_cntl to recommended value for production env */
> +	psl_fircntl = (0x2ULL << (63-3)); /* ce_report */
> +	psl_fircntl |= (0x1ULL << (63-6)); /* FIR_report */
> +	psl_fircntl |= 0x1ULL; /* ce_thresh */
> +	cxl_p1_write(adapter, CXL_PSL_FIR_CNTL, psl_fircntl);
>  	/* for debugging with trace arrays */
>  	cxl_p1_write(adapter, CXL_PSL_TRACE, 0x0000FF7C00000000ULL);
